    XBOX ONE wireless network hardware problems

    Please try this. I have had it resolve this issue a number of times. Perform a hard reset EXACTLY like this. Hold the power button on the console for 10 seconds or until the power shuts down completely. Unplug the power cord from the back of the console
    for 5 minutes. Plug the power cord back in and restart the console. Once it is back up and operational test the results. Let us know. Good Luck!!

    If that doesn't work you could also opt to run it wired.

    Xbox Connection Troubles

    Hello Greta D, my name is Vanessa, I will be happy to help you in any way I can.

    Has this problem been happening to you when trying to connect via wireless network? If so, follow these steps:

    A wireless router broadcasts the network name (SSID) every few seconds. If a router is not broadcasting the network name, your console may not be able to "see" the wireless network.

    If no other wireless devices detect your network, the problem is with your router and not your console. To fix the problem, first verify that the router is broadcasting the correct SSID. Consult your router's documentation or manufacturer's website for information on how to configure and update your specific networking hardware.

    Once you've checked the SSID your router is broadcasting, configure the wireless settings on your console and use the SSID your router is broadcasting. For help, see:
